GE Multilin Feeder Protection and IEC 61850 Communication Features
The F650BFBF1G0HICE integrates feeder protection logic, bay control functions, and communication processing within the GE Multilin 650 platform. The relay supports deterministic protection processing for ANSI functions including 50/51 phase overcurrent, 50N/51N ground overcurrent, 67/67N directional overcurrent, 27/59 voltage protection, 81 frequency protection, 50BF breaker failure, and 79 autoreclose control.
The integrated logic engine supports IEC 61131-3 programmable control functions for interlocking, transfer schemes, load shedding, and breaker control sequences. Communication functions include IEC 61850 Edition 2, Modbus RTU/TCP, DNP3, and IEC 60870-5-104 protocol operation through the configured communication interfaces.

Q: Does the F650BFBF1G0HICE support hot-swap replacement during energized operation? A: The available documentation does not specify hot-swap capability. Replacement should follow standard protection relay isolation procedures with auxiliary supply and field wiring disconnected before removal.
Q: What is the digital input and output hardware capacity of this configuration? A: The configuration includes 16 configurable digital inputs and 8 programmable relay outputs. Input filtering and output assignment are configured through the relay settings.
Q: Which communication interfaces are supported by this model configuration? A: This model supports IEC 61850 Edition 2, Modbus RTU/TCP, DNP3, and IEC 60870-5-104 communication protocols through its configured Ethernet and serial interfaces.
Field Installation Guidelines
Install the relay in a suitable protection panel enclosure with controlled grounding, ventilation, and access clearance according to the installation requirements of the GE Multilin 650 series.
Terminate CT and VT wiring using dedicated protection terminal blocks. Maintain separation between low-level communication wiring and high-energy current or voltage circuits to reduce electromagnetic interference.
Connect the protective earth terminal using an appropriate grounding conductor. Apply shield grounding practices for communication cables according to the selected protocol installation standard.
Verify auxiliary supply polarity and voltage range before energization. The HI power supply option accepts 110-250 V DC and 120-230 V AC input ranges within the specified operating limits.
Perform secondary injection testing after installation to verify protection elements, trip outputs, breaker control logic, and communication data exchange.
